Glasgow City HSCP’s Homeless Health and Asylum Service is People’s Choice Winner at Scottish Health Awards
Huge congratulations to Glasgow City Health and Social Care Partnership’s (HSCP) Homeless Health and Asylum Service (now called Complex Needs and Asylum Health Services) who were announced as the winner of the People's Choice Award at the Scottish Health Awards 2021 on Thursday, 4 November.
National Award for Pharmacy Led Pain Clinic
A pharmacist-led pain clinic in Govanhill Health Centre has won a national award for the ‘Addressing Overprescribing’ category and an overall Silver Award, as voted by the audience, at the PrescQIPP Annual Awards 2021. The winners were announced at an online award ceremony on 13 October.
